Ceramics boast impressive strength and durability, but their inherent rigidity and brittleness have long hindered applications demanding flexibility, such as filters, sensors, wearable devices and flexible electronics. Materials scientists have pursued methods to capture the desirable properties of ceramics like titania and zirconia in a flexible fiber form.
